The Problem

Indie hackers and solo founders using Vercel, Supabase, Railway, and GitHub Actions face mid-sprint outages from unmonitored quotas, with no unified dashboard across these devtools.[signal description] Cloud cost tools like CloudZero and Datadog manage enterprise spend but ignore niche platform limits, leading to surprise disruptions. Developers currently spend $15-49/month on partial monitoring solutions, yet still hit outages due to siloed views.

Competitive Landscape

CloudZero

$19 per $1K/month AWS spend (On Demand, AWS Marketplace)[2]

Direct

CloudZero excels in multi-cloud cost allocation and unit economics but lacks specific quota alerting for service limits like Vercel or Supabase usage thresholds, focusing more on spend optimization than pre-outage warnings.

Datadog Cloud Cost Management

Infrastructure Pro $15/host/month (annual)[1]

Direct

Datadog CCM provides cloud cost monitoring and anomaly detection across AWS, GCP, Azure but does not offer unified quota dashboards or alerts for niche dev platforms like Railway or GitHub Actions limits.

Cloudchipr

$49/month for up to $5k monthly cloud spend[2]

Adjacent

Cloudchipr offers tiered cost optimization based on cloud spend but misses real-time quota tracking and alerting for dev-specific services like Supabase or Vercel, emphasizing broader SMB spend management.

VMware Aria Cost (CloudHealth)

Custom pricing (request quote)

Indirect

Aria Cost provides multi-cloud governance, rightsizing, and forecasting for AWS, Azure, GCP but lacks integration with indie dev platforms like GitHub Actions or Vercel for quota-specific outage prevention.

Splunk Observability Cloud

$15/host/mo (Infrastructure, annual)[1]

Adjacent

Splunk focuses on host-based monitoring with cost views but does not provide a single dashboard for approaching quotas across mixed devtools like Vercel, Supabase, and Railway, prioritizing enterprise-scale observability.
